Android BluetoothAdapter模拟
全部标签如何理解React通过对DOM的模拟,最大限度地减少与DOM的交互背景分析关于虚拟DOM背景在学习React的过程中,发现很多文档上关于React的高效都有这么一句话的描述——React通过对DOM的模拟,最大限度地减少与DOM的交互,对于我这种前端小白来说,理解起来还是挺费劲的,所以找了些文档学习了一番。分析在查找资料的过程中,笔者发现关于这句话的描述其实包含着下面的知识点:虚拟DOM:React引入了虚拟DOM的概念。虚拟DOM是一个存在于内存中的树形结构,它对应着实际的DOM树。在React中,组件的状态变化会首先在虚拟DOM上进行操作,而不是直接操作实际的DOM。关于虚拟DOM这里我们
虚拟链路是什么?简单来讲虚拟链路是连接OSPF不同区域的链路,这条链路看不到,是虚拟的,所以叫做虚拟链路,通过虚拟链路的配置可以实现OSPF多区域的互通。OSPF是一个分区域的路由协议,area0是他的骨干区域,其他区域如果想互相通信就要和骨干区域进行直连,直连不到就有了虚拟链路的产生。情景分析:在R1、R2、R3、R4之间配置OSPF协议,分别建立区域Area0、Area1、Area2,Area0为骨干区域。建立区域后发现R4无法ping通R1,此时建立一条虚拟链路即可完成互相通信(使用下一跳也可) 步骤一、根据拓补图配置路由器的端口IP,以及环回IPR1配置:Router>ENRouter
在二维平面上,有一个机器人从原点(0,0)开始。给出它的移动顺序,判断这个机器人在完成移动后是否在(0,0)处结束。移动顺序由字符串moves表示。字符move[i]表示其第i次移动。机器人的有效动作有R(右),L(左),U(上)和D(下)。如果机器人在完成所有动作后返回原点,则返回true。否则,返回false。注意:机器人“面朝”的方向无关紧要。“R”将始终使机器人向右移动一次,“L”将始终向左移动等。此外,假设每次移动机器人的移动幅度相同。示例1:输入:moves=“UD”输出:true解释:机器人向上移动一次,然后向下移动一次。所有动作都具有相同的幅度,因此它最终回到它开始的原点。因此
Xcode15安装包的大小相比之前更小,因为除了macOS的Components,其他都需要动态下载安装,否则提示iOS17SimulatorNotInstalled。如果不安装对应的运行模拟库无法真机和模拟器运行,更无法新建项目。但是由于模拟器安装包过大且不支持断点续传,在经历了在线安装N次失败后,决定采用离线的方式安装,最后成功了。安装步骤—以iOS模拟器为例xcode内部文件夹根据官网指导下载iOS_17_Simulator_Runtime.dmg。双击iOS_17_Simulator_Runtime.dmg文件,等待打开后,逐层找到Runtimes文件夹。选择Xcode15App,然后
路由器可以实现不同网络之间主机的通信(若使用交换机实现不同网络之间的主机通讯,则数据包是以广播方式发出,一是没有数据安全性,二是大量广播包会消耗主机资源)路由器在企业中的主要应用网络互联:主要用于互联局域网和广域网,实现不同网络间互相通信。数据处理:提供包括分组过滤、分组转发、优先级、复用、加密、压缩和防火墙等功能。网络管理:路由器提供包括路由器配置管理、性能管理、容错管理和流量控制等路由器的工作机制关注以下两点:路由器识别数据地址信息利用路由器作为数据传输的中转设备,进行数据中转时不能再使用MAC地址作为目标终端的识别信息;因为若仍使用MAC地址进行识别,会造成广播风暴问题的产生,本身路由器
最近更新的博客华为od2023|什么是华为od,od薪资待遇,od机试题清单华为OD机试真题大全,用Python解华为机试题|机试宝典【华为OD机试】全流程解析+经验分享,题型分享,防作弊指南华为od机试,独家整理已参加机试人员的实战技巧本篇题解:基站维修工程师题目橡皮擦是一名基站维护工程师,负责某区域的基站维护。某地方有n个基站(1),已知各基站之间的距离s(0),并且基站x到基站y的距离,与基站y到基站x的距离并不一定会相同。橡皮擦从基站1出发,途经每个基站1次,然后返回基站1,需要请你为他选择一条距离最短的路。
关于hadoop-minicluster我需要你的帮助我正在使用scala(使用sbt)并尝试模拟HDFS的调用。我播种hadoop-minicluster用于部署一个小集群并在其上进行测试。但是,当我添加sbt依赖时:libraryDependencies+="org.apache.hadoop"%"hadoop-minicluster"%"3.1.0"%测试没有添加源,我无法导入包org.apache.hadoop.hdfs.MiniDFSCluster你知道我怎么解决这个问题吗?谢谢你的回答 最佳答案 令人惊讶的是,它不在ha
IC卡在我们身边已随处可见,被广泛应用于各种领域。大多数人每天都要和各种各样的卡片打交道,上班有考勤卡,吃饭有饭卡,健身有会员卡,停车有停车卡,连回个家都得先把门禁卡翻出来。各种各样的卡,方便我们生活的同时也为我们的生活带来一点点不便。如果你有一部带有NFC功能的手机,那就太好了,可以把这些卡片统统收纳起来,放入手机中,再也不用带那么多卡片出门了。如果感兴趣,就快来跟我一起去实验操作一下吧。工欲善其事必先利其器,软硬件设备列表:1、硬件设备(读卡器):proxmark3easy(PM3),主要作用是解密卡片,读取卡片数据,将数据写入手机手表手环等,属于必须物品。2、配套软件(艾斯PM3软件助手
引入共识机制(PoW)importhashlibfromdatetimeimportdatetimeclassBlock:"""区块结构prev_hash:父区块哈希值data:区块内容timestamp:区块创建时间hash:区块哈希值Nonce:随机数"""def__init__(self,data,prev_hash):#将传入的父哈希值和数据保存到类变量中self.prev_hash=prev_hashself.data=data#获取当前时间self.timestamp=datetime.now().strftime("%Y-%m-%d%H:%M:%S")#设置Nonce和哈希的初始
文章目录前言下载github地址:网盘关于VideoWebpagesYoutube和流媒体ShadersGIFs游戏和应用程序&more:Performance:多监视器支持:完结前言LivelyWallpaper是一款开源的视频壁纸桌面软件,类似WallpaperEngine,兼容WallpaperEngine视频包文件,可以把视频文件、GiF文件、模拟器、HTML、网址、着色器和游戏转换为Win桌面壁纸,不依赖Steam,视频包自寻。运行全屏应用程序或游戏时,墙纸停止播放,零占用率。下载github地址:https://github.com/rocksdanister/lively网盘外网